Malaysia’s NationGate was caught in the fallout of Singapore’s investigation into the alleged fraudulent transfer of Nvidia’s advanced artificial intelligence chips, sending its shares crashing nearly 30 per cent on Monday (Mar 3) before trading was halted for an hour on Tuesday (Mar 4). The data centre solutions provider has denied any involvement in the ongoing fraud case. The Straits Times' Malaysia Bureau Chief, Shannon Teoh weighs in with reactions from Malaysia. Shannon also shares his views on the potential of smuggling activities for restricted technology, and the impact of the AI chips probe on Malaysia's growing electronics chips market.
